    I can understand everyone's position on this, but I am thinking of a different angle.

    We know the Jerseys will be red. And probably some grey.

    We know the sizes will probably be about the same as last years. (So fit isn't an issue)

    We know it will have a BMO Logo and a TFC crest (hopefully not felt again).

    We know it will probably be inline with "Adidas" already existing jersey formats. (Meaning probably little chance of KC Wizards ugliness.)

    What exactly are we afraid of? We know that new jerseys every couple of years is a cash grab...because that is business! For those of us that buy jerseys of other teams like Barcelona or Manchester United...do we not eventually buy the "new" jersey once we have decided to get it? How is that not a cash grab and this is? They both are. All teams supplement their coffers with redesigned kits and the fans buy them in droves, why would TFC avoid this money-making venture and why would we have a problem with it? So the real question is, have you decided you are getting the new jersey or not? Is design going to influence you? Cost? Neither of these should really be an issue here as all of us knew already what the price was going to be, and most of us here are smart enough to know what the kits will probably look like, maybe a change to a swoosh here, or a line there, but I doubt we are going to get Chelsea Flourescent.

    I am a jersey collector, I love all my kits and since this is my team, I can't fathom the thought of not having a complete collection. Isn't $119.99 the same price as the authentics from last year? I wasn't expecting any less this year. So what exactly would I complain about since I know pretty much the look of the jersey and the price is inline with last year?
